Phuongan Dam is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biomedical Engineering and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Phuongan Dam has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 873 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 4 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Phuongan Dam's work include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(12 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(7 papers) and Machine Learning in Bioinformatics (5 papers). Phuongan Dam is often cited by papers focused on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(12 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(7 papers) and Machine Learning in Bioinformatics (5 papers). Phuongan Dam coll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and India. Phuongan Dam's co-authors include Ying Xu, Victor Olman, Fenglou Mao, Zhengchang Su, Kyle Harris, Yanbin Yin, Michael W. W. Adams, Irina Kataeva, Janet Westpheling and Sungjae Yang and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nucleic Acids Research and Journal of Clinical Oncology.
